Transaction 3610494f58d10924e08a78dbae74cc6a1110c49b69181a6d9feed5cb91643a8b

1 Input
2 Outputs
  • 3610494f58d10924e08a78dbae74cc6a1110c49b69181a6d9feed5cb91643a8b:0
  • value  35578341
    address  3FHvE2X3epg78pTU6cmPdutpzfToRu2WN2
  • 3610494f58d10924e08a78dbae74cc6a1110c49b69181a6d9feed5cb91643a8b:1
  • value  2080000
    address  13Kdsi58gtcHhpHZF3WpEPNAcPv46mRUJW